I know this is an older video but his plate voltage at 2100 is low, I'd bet if he replaced the power supply capacitors it would be back up to 2400 volts and put out more like 600-700 watts. Stock is 125uf, I replaced mine with 180uf - any higher and you want to install a soft start circuit to minimize inrush current.
